Sea Spell by LUCkY SAiLORs published on 2022-03-01T04:12:47Z Sea songs ... I first wrote one in the early 80s while living high and dry in north Texas. Flash forward nearly 20 years and I found myself volunteering as a crew member aboard the historic tall ship Elissa in Galveston while living aboard the 32' sloop Libertine. A few years after that, I'd married a lovely lass from Great Britain and moved aboard a 38' sloop named Sea Spell. Admiral Jo and I set out to sail the East Coasts and Caribbean for a few years. Along the way we wrote a variety of saltwater influenced songs ... from traditional sea shanties and calypso infused reggae to blues and country infused ditties. We've now moved high and dry to Colorado, but we finally got around to recording that collection. Enjoy!
